Common additions include: B1 (Thiamine): Supports carbohydrate metabolism and energy production B2 (Riboflavin): Required for fat and protein metabolism B3 (Niacinamide): Supports over 400 enzyme reactions, including those involved in energy metabolism B5 (Dexpanthenol): Essential for the synthesis of coenzyme A, which is required for fatty acid metabolism B6 (Pyridoxine): Supports amino acid metabolism and neurotransmitter synthesis B12 (Methylcobalamin/Cyanocobalamin): Critical for energy production, red blood cell formation, and methylation reactions Why they matter: B vitamins are cofactors in virtually every metabolic process
